Why choose a cream bronzer over powder?
While there might not be much unanimity over whether cream or powder bronzer is ‘better’, the beauty community agrees that each option has its upsides. Cream formulas give a more natural, dewy finish than powder, which is particularly good for dry and mature skin. As for coverage, cream bronzer is also considered more buildable and easier to blend into the skin. Inversely, if you have oily skin, you might prefer the mattifying effect of powder, which also tends to last longer.

How to apply
For the best results, apply your cream bronzer with either a beauty blender or dense stipple brush. As for how much is needed, always start with a little less than you think (as some creams are more pigmented than others), and work up until you achieve your desired coverage.
